Challenges in Work Truck Trailer Fleet Management
Despite its importance, work truck trailer fleet management comes with its own set of challenges that fleet managers need to address effectively. Some of the key challenges faced by fleet managers include:
1. Maintenance and Repairs: Work truck trailers undergo significant wear and tear due to their heavy-duty usage, requiring regular maintenance and timely repairs to ensure optimal performance and safety.
2. Driver Safety and Compliance: Ensuring driver safety and compliance with regulations, such as hours of service and vehicle maintenance requirements, is crucial to avoid accidents, violations, and associated liabilities.
3. Fuel Costs: Fuel expenses can account for a significant portion of operating costs for work truck trailers, making it essential to monitor fuel consumption, optimize routes, and reduce idle times to lower fuel expenses.
4. Asset Tracking and Security: Managing a large fleet of work truck trailers across different locations can be challenging, requiring efficient asset tracking systems to monitor vehicle whereabouts and prevent theft or unauthorized usage.
5. Data Management and Analysis: Collecting and analyzing data related to fleet operations, such as vehicle performance, driver behavior, and maintenance records, is essential for making informed decisions and improving efficiency.
Best Practices for Optimizing Work Truck Trailer Fleet Operations
To overcome the challenges in work truck trailer fleet management and maximize efficiency, fleet managers can implement various best practices tailored to their specific needs and operational requirements. Some of the best practices for optimizing work truck trailer fleet operations include:
1. Regular Maintenance and Inspections: Establishing a proactive maintenance schedule for work truck trailers can help prevent breakdowns, extend vehicle lifespan, and ensure compliance with safety regulations.
2. Driver Training and Monitoring: Providing drivers with proper training on safe driving practices, fuel-efficient techniques, and regulatory compliance can enhance overall fleet safety and performance.
3. Route Optimization: Utilizing route planning software and GPS tracking systems can optimize routes, minimize fuel consumption, reduce travel times, and improve delivery efficiency.
4. Telematics and IoT Integration: Implementing telematics systems and IoT devices in work truck trailers can provide real-time data on vehicle performance, driver behavior, fuel usage, and maintenance needs for informed decision-making.
5. Fleet Management Software: Investing in fleet management software solutions can centralize data management, automate tasks, generate reports, and streamline operations for enhanced productivity.
6. Performance Monitoring and KPIs: Setting key performance indicators (KPIs) for fleet operations, such as vehicle utilization rates, maintenance costs, fuel efficiency, and driver safety scores, can help track performance and identify areas for improvement.
7. Collaboration and Communication: Encouraging open communication and collaboration among fleet managers, drivers, maintenance teams, and other stakeholders can foster a culture of accountability, teamwork, and continuous improvement.
Technological Advancements in Work Truck Trailer Fleet Management
The advent of advanced technologies has revolutionized work truck trailer fleet management, offering innovative solutions to address the challenges faced by fleet managers and enhance operational efficiency. Some of the latest technological advancements transforming work truck trailer fleet management include:
1. Predictive Maintenance Systems: Predictive maintenance systems use data analytics and machine learning algorithms to predict potential equipment failures before they occur, allowing fleet managers to schedule maintenance tasks proactively and avoid unplanned downtime.
2. Autonomous Vehicles: Autonomous work truck trailers equipped with self-driving technology can enhance safety, efficiency, and productivity by eliminating the need for human drivers and enabling continuous operation without rest breaks.
3. Electric and Hybrid Vehicles: Electric and hybrid work truck trailers offer a more sustainable and cost-effective alternative to traditional diesel vehicles, reducing fuel expenses, emissions, and reliance on fossil fuels.
4. Real-Time Fleet Monitoring: Real-time fleet monitoring systems utilize GPS tracking, telematics, and IoT sensors to provide instant updates on vehicle locations, performance metrics, driver behavior, and maintenance alerts for improved visibility and control.
5. Cloud-Based Fleet Management Software: Cloud-based fleet management software solutions enable remote access to data, real-time collaboration, automated reporting, and scalability for businesses of all sizes to manage their work truck trailer fleets efficiently.
6. Blockchain Technology: Blockchain technology can enhance security, transparency, and traceability in work truck trailer fleet management by creating tamper-proof records of vehicle transactions, maintenance histories, and driver credentials.
7. Mobile Applications: Mobile applications designed for fleet managers and drivers offer convenient access to critical information, such as trip planning, maintenance schedules, fuel purchases, and compliance requirements, on-the-go.
